Acting Administrator Lenhardt will travel to New York for the 70th UN General Assembly

WASHINGTON, D.C. - Acting Administrator of the U.S. Agency for International Development (USAID) Ambassador Alfonso Lenhardt, will travel to New York to participate in the 70th UN General Assembly from September 26-29. This year's gathering is especially important as the UN will host the Sustainable Development Summit,September 25-27, where world leaders will adopt a new set of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s), which will stimulate action for the next 15 years.  

On September 27th, USAID will host world leaders and the international community for a Signature Event on "Ending Extreme Poverty and Achieving the SDGs through Partnership". The event will include a "call to action" for doers, entrepreneurs and inventors to join the fight against extreme poverty through our Development Innovation Ventures (DIV). Ambassador Lenhardt will deliver opening remarks. Other speakers include Unilever CEO Paul Polman, Australia Minister of Foreign Affairs Julie Bishop, and United Kingdom Secretary of State for International Development Justine Greening.

While in New York, Ambassador Lenhardt will participate in a host of events;

  • A meeting of global health leaders chaired by World Bank President Jim Kim and World Health Organization Director-General Margaret Chan;
  • United Nations Sustainable Development Goals Dialogue 5: Building Effective, Accountable, and Inclusive Institutions;
  • A meeting on the humanitarian crisis in Yemen hosted by the United Kingdom Department for International Development;
  • Innovation in a Post-2015 World: How New Approaches to Development can unleash the Power of Human Enterprise, an event hosted by the Rockefeller Foundation, USAID, and other development agencies and organizations;
  • A breakfast on education in emergencies hosted by the Global Business Coalition for Education; and
  • An event focusing on countering violent extremism organized by USAID and partners at the United Nations.

In addition, Ambassador Lenhardt will also host a series of bilateral meetings with government and business leaders.
